Apple cake with or without ice cream is a hit no matter the season, but it's especially good in the fall. At least if you're lucky enough to have an apple tree in your garden!
Here is a gluten-free version, you can of course use regular wheat flour. I used 200 grams of gluten-free fine wheat flour and 50 grams of chickpea flour. A traditional recipe is to take equal amounts of butter, wheat flour and sugar! I have started baking all cakes with less sugar than what is written in the recipes, including my own It's going great!
This is what you need:
150 gr room temperature butter
150 g sugar
250 gr flour of your choice
½ teaspoon baking powder
3 apples in boats
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
10-15 coarsely chopped almonds
Procedure:
- Peel the apples, cut into thin slices and sprinkle with sugar and cinnamon.
- Beat butter and sugar until slightly fluffy. Add flour and baking powder. Mix well.
- Pour the mixture into a greased tin, garnish with apple wedges and chopped almonds.
- Bake for 25 minutes at 180 degrees. Serve with or without ice cream and a delicious cup of coffee.
